Larry Mercey Trio at RAC

        The Larry Mercey Trio along with New Brunswick's Ambassador of fiddling, Ivan Hicks and his wife, Vivian, will be in concert at the Riverview Arts Centre, Riverview High School on Thursday, May 10, 2007.

        Larry Mercey is a respected Canadian Music icon who lias been in the business for nearly 50 years- He started his career on the CKNX Barn E>arvce broadcasting from Wmgham. ON in 1956. He then formed the group "The Mercey Brothers" who have the honor of being inducted into the Canadian Country musk Hall of Fame. This group recorded 17 albums (including a Gold Album) and some 50 singles, most of them reaching the rawnber one spot on the country charts. Some of their hits included "Who Wrote the Words", "Hey Uncle Tom", "Hello, Mom" and "The Day of Love",

        Larry has appealed on some of the largest concert stages such as Toronto CNE Grandstand, Ontario Place, Big Country Jamboree at Craven, SK, as well as tours in England, the Netherlands, Germany, Sweden and Finland and on Nashville's Grand Ole Opry Stage

        Awards have included seven Junos, numerous Big Country Awards and the prestigious C. F. Martin Guitar Lifetime Achievement Award, With the Mercey Brothers, Larry represented Canada on the International Show at the Nashville Fitn Fair and & the World's Fair in Knoxville, Tennessee.

        The Larry Mercey Trk) was formed in 2004. Besides, Larry, George Lonsbury is a talented guitar player who plays with precision and taste and adds immensely to the sound of the trio. He also sings the low harmony in the trio. Al Aldersoa is the bass player wjho provides the feel that makes their music special. He sings the high harmony in the group. They present a good mix of country so'itnds with Gospel.

        The title of the Trio's current CD says it all "It's Not Over Yet". With the success of the single from the CD "On My Father's Side", The Larry Mercey Trio is continuing a music tradition.
